FRANCISTOWN: A 50-year-old Zimbabwean mechanic working for Mupane Gold Mine on Tuesday died while pumping a Load Haul Dump (LHD) loader tyre which later exploded.

Mupane general manager, Cedric Sam confirmed the incident in an interview with Mmegi. Indications are that the 50-year-old employee sustained fatal injuries when the tyre he was pumping exploded. “I cannot go into details about the incident, but I can certainly confirm that one of our mechanics died while inflating a tyre for one our LHD loaders. Investigations are still on-going.

So far, the police have been to the scene and we are waiting for officials from the department of mines to come and do their investigations,” Sam said late yesterday. Officials from the department of mine arrived in Francistown from Gaborone yesterday afternoon. They were expected to carry out investigations at the mine for the better part of today. Mupane gold mine is located in Northeastern Botswana 30km South East of Francistown. It is the country’s sole gold operation.
